What's The Definition Of Punchboard?
punchboard in British English
a board or card with holes containing concealed slips or disks to be punched out, used in games of chance, raffles, etc.: the slips or disks bear numbers, names, prize designations, or the like noun: a board full of holes containing slips of paper, used in a gambling game in which a player attempts to push out a slip marked with a winning number noun: a small board containing holes filled with slips of paper printed with concealed numbers that are punched out by a player in an attempt to win a prize |
